Clean off the excess mastic on the body. Clean (if necessary) both surfaces. Use a bead of new mastic about 10mm thick and run this along the existing mastic bead on the skirt. This will save you having to prime the surfaces. Gently align the skirt and rivet it into place while wet. I used Sika Tack...

This method has worked for me twice. Obtain a piece of steel about 1m long, 30mm by 5mm section (or thereabouts). Grind a chisel-style point on one end about 30mm long. Drill out rivets and remove rear wheel. There is a gap at the back of the rear skirt, locate the 'chisel' in there so it is facing ...
